How to optimize performance of Java anonymous inner classes?

May 02, 2024 am 08:48 AM
java anonymous inner class

The performance problem of anonymous inner classes is that they are recreated every time they are used, which can be optimized through the following strategies: 1. Store anonymous inner classes in local variables; 2. Use non-static inner classes; 3. Use lambda expressions. Practical tests show that lambda expression optimization works best.

Introduction

Anonymous inner classes are An anonymous class that has no explicit name. They are often used in methods to create objects that quickly implement interfaces or inherited classes. Although anonymous inner classes are convenient to use, they can also have a negative impact on performance.

Performance Issues

Performance issues with anonymous inner classes mainly stem from the fact that they are recreated every time they are used. This results in unnecessary object allocation and initialization overhead.

Optimization Strategy

The main strategy for optimizing the performance of anonymous inner classes is to avoid recreating them every time they are used. This can be achieved by:

1. Storing anonymous inner classes in local variables

// 每次使用时新建匿名内部类
JButton button = new JButton();
button.addActionListener(new ActionListener() {
    @Override
    public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ent e) {
        // ...
    }
});

// 将匿名内部类存储在局部变量中
ActionListener listener = new ActionListener() {
    @Override
    public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ent e) {
        // ...
    }
};
button.addActionListener(listener);
Copy after login

3. Using lambda expressions

In Java 8 and above, you can use lambda expressions instead of anonymous inner classes. Lambda expressions are more concise and avoid repeated object creation.

JButton button = new JButton();
button.addActionListener(e -> System.out.println(button.getText()));
Copy after login
